Moved renderering system and model loading into CyberarmEngine, added island_test_map

This commit is contained in:
2020-07-15 21:28:57 -05:00
parent 9264ef6e58
commit 65cfc1a124
29 changed files with 6357 additions and 1874 deletions

162
svg/faction_two_ghort.svg Normal file
View File

@@ -0,0 +1,162 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<svg
xmlns:dc="http://purl.org/dc/elements/1.1/"
xmlns:cc="http://creativecommons.org/ns#"
x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
xmlns:svg="http://www.w3.org/2000/svg"
xmlns="http://www.w3.org/2000/svg"
xmlns:sodipodi="http://sodipodi.sourceforge.net/DTD/sodipodi-0.dtd"
xmlns:inkscape="http://www.inkscape.org/namespaces/inkscape"
sodipodi:docname="faction_two_ghort.svg"
inkscape:version="1.0 (4035a4fb49, 2020-05-01)"
id="svg86"
version="1.1"
viewBox="0 0 33.866666 33.866668"
height="128"
width="128">
<defs
id="defs80" />
<sodipodi:namedview
inkscape:snap-bbox-midpoints="true"
inkscape:window-maximized="1"
inkscape:window-y="0"
inkscape:window-x="0"
inkscape:window-height="1010"
inkscape:window-width="1920"
inkscape:snap-bbox-edge-midpoints="true"
inkscape:bbox-nodes="true"
inkscape:snap-bbox="true"
inkscape:snap-nodes="true"
inkscape:guide-bbox="true"
showguides="true"
inkscape:showpageshadow="false"
units="px"
showgrid="false"
inkscape:document-rotation="0"
inkscape:current-layer="layer3"
inkscape:document-units="px"
inkscape:cy="73.014627"
inkscape:cx="28.305817"
inkscape:zoom="4"
inkscape:pageshadow="2"
inkscape:pageopacity="0.0"
borderopacity="1.0"
bordercolor="#666666"
pagecolor="#ffffff"
id="base">
<inkscape:grid
empspacing="8"
id="grid88"
type="xygrid" />
<sodipodi:guide
inkscape:color="rgb(0,0,255)"
inkscape:locked="false"
inkscape:label=""
id="guide94"
orientation="0,1"
position="16.933333,16.933333" />
<sodipodi:guide
id="guide99"
orientation="0,-1"
position="16.933333,29.633334" />
<sodipodi:guide
id="guide101"
orientation="0,-1"
position="16.933333,4.2333335" />
<sodipodi:guide
id="guide103"
orientation="1,0"
position="6.3499999,14.816667" />
<sodipodi:guide
id="guide105"
orientation="1,0"
position="27.516666,14.816667" />
<sodipodi:guide
id="guide107"
orientation="0,-1"
position="16.933333,10.583334" />
<sodipodi:guide
id="guide109"
orientation="0,-1"
position="16.933333,25.400001" />
</sodipodi:namedview>
<metadata
id="metadata83">
<rdf:RDF>
<cc:Work
rdf:about="">
<dc:format>image/svg+xml</dc:format>
<dc:type
rdf:resource="http://purl.org/dc/dcmitype/StillImage" />
<dc:title></dc:title>
</cc:Work>
</rdf:RDF>
</metadata>
<g
sodipodi:insensitive="true"
id="layer1"
inkscape:groupmode="layer"
inkscape:label="Layer 1">
<path
d="M 31.59803,25.400001 16.933334,33.866667 2.2686381,25.4 2.2686382,8.4666679 16.933334,1.7798752e-6 31.59803,8.4666681 Z"
inkscape:randomized="0"
inkscape:rounded="0"
inkscape:flatsided="true"
sodipodi:arg2="1.0471976"
sodipodi:arg1="0.52359878"
sodipodi:r2="14.664696"
sodipodi:r1="16.933332"
sodipodi:cy="16.933334"
sodipodi:cx="16.933334"
sodipodi:sides="6"
id="path96"
style="fill:#f9f06b;stroke-width:6.35;stroke-linecap:round;paint-order:stroke markers fill"
sodipodi:type="star" />
</g>
<g
inkscape:label="Layer 2"
id="layer3"
inkscape:groupmode="layer">
<g
style="stroke:none"
id="g1018-5">
<path
sodipodi:nodetypes="ccccc"
transform="scale(0.26458334)"
d="M 64,32 31.999999,41.999999 32,72 63.999999,63.999999 Z"
style="fill:#8ff0a4;stroke:none;stroke-width:1;stroke-linecap:butt;stroke-linejoin:round;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1;paint-order:normal"
id="path128-6" />
<path
sodipodi:nodetypes="ccccc"
transform="scale(0.26458334)"
d="m 64,32 -10e-7,31.999999 L 96,72 l -10e-7,-30.000001 z"
style="fill:#33d17a;stroke:none;stroke-width:1;stroke-linecap:butt;stroke-linejoin:round;stroke-miterlimit:4;stroke-dasharray:none;stroke-opacity:1;paint-order:normal"
id="path113-2" />
</g>
<ellipse
ry="1.5875005"
rx="3.1750009"
cy="16.404167"
cx="16.933334"
id="path1010"
style="fill:#813d9c;stroke-width:0.264584;stroke-linecap:round;stroke-linejoin:round;stroke-miterlimit:4;stroke-dasharray:none;paint-order:normal" />
<path
transform="scale(0.26458334)"
d="M 64 16 L 64 32 L 96 42 L 96 72 L 64 64 L 64 112 L 104 88 L 104 32 L 64 16 z "
style="fill:#a51d2d;stroke:#ffffff;stroke-width:0.99999998;stroke-linecap:butt;stroke-linejoin:round;stroke-opacity:1;stroke-miterlimit:4;stroke-dasharray:none"
id="path111" />
<path
transform="scale(0.26458334)"
d="M 64 16 L 24 32 L 24 88 L 64 112 L 64 64 L 32 72 L 32 42 L 64 32 L 64 16 z "
style="fill:#ed333b;stroke:#ffffff;stroke-width:0.999999px;stroke-linecap:butt;stroke-linejoin:round;stroke-opacity:1"
id="path122" />
<path
id="path1012"
d="M 25.400001,21.166667 19.05,25.400001"
style="fill:none;stroke:#ffffff;stroke-width:0.264583px;stroke-linecap:butt;stroke-linejoin:miter;stroke-opacity:1" />
<path
id="path1014"
d="M 14.816667,25.400001 8.4666669,21.166667"
style="fill:none;stroke:#ffffff;stroke-width:0.264583px;stroke-linecap:butt;stroke-linejoin:miter;stroke-opacity:1" />
</g>
</svg>

After

Width:  |  Height:  |  Size: 5.5 KiB